Returns the number of interval boundaries between two dates. Date = Calendar ( Date (Start date), Date (End date)) Create date table on Power BI Desktop Here we create a date table having dates from 1/1/2020 to 31/12/2021. Use the CALENDAR function when you want to define a date range. But Power BI Desktop has a data view and a model view where you can peek inside your dataset. The custom format string property of the columns can be modified in the diagram view. A full script of a date dimension is available here in this article for you available to download; Thanks for this awesome solution easy to set up. Pssst Make sure to check out our free Excel training that adapts to your skill level too! Im using Microsoft Power BI Desktop on a Windows 10 64-bit system. Unfortunately, I dont think it can be achieved using DAX, but can be done in M using parameters. For more information about creating calculated tables, including an example of how to create a date table, work through the Add calculated tables and columns to Power BI Desktop models learning module. @navee1990 the measure to extract the date and year is as follows. I need to sort by month as you explained in the article I got it to work. Ensure that the slicer header is turned on. For more information about this automatic behavior, see Apply auto date/time in Power BI Desktop. If you deselect the date table, Power BI will automatically create a new Auto Date table. Can archive.org's Wayback Machine ignore some query terms? Partner is not responding when their writing is needed in European project application. Launch Power BI. With the recent introduction of custom format strings in Power BI, we can use a different approach that no longer requires additional columns, and that can also remove the need to use the Sort by Column feature. Create date tables in Power BI Desktop - Power BI | Microsoft Learn By combining data lakes, rivers, glaciers, and seas, it offers enhanced scalability, flexibility, and efficiency for todays data-driven organizations. What's more, within an organization a date table should be consistently defined. Empowering organisations to move from a time consuming frustration with reporting processes into modern dynamic interactive visualizations is what he takes pleasure in. how do I sort the months in my charts by natural month order? Read more, This article introduces the Data Ecosystem, an innovative evolution of the modern data warehouse architecture. Power BI creates an internal date table for you, but it wont always produce the filtering and grouping requirements that you need. Unfortunately, we cannot use this technique for the quarter because the custom format syntax does not support quarters. We can see a date column appears on the data model. After that it will be displayed this way: http://databear.com/wp-content/uploads/2016/12/image003.png. DAY: Returns the day of the month, a number from 1 to 31. The DATESMTD requires the Date column. To the far. Once you decide the default Auto Date table isnt adequate, you can create one that fulfills your grouping and filtering requirements in Microsoft Power BI. not by a particular date (example: 01/05/2021). Asking for help, clarification, or responding to other answers. I strongly suggest using a Date dimension (or calendar table) including all the columns for slicing and dicing by date-related attributes. You have to select Table Tools > New Table in Power BI report view, once that is done, you can populate your table by this function. It's the case when date is a role playing dimension. If you don't have a data warehouse or other consistent definition for time in your organization, consider using Power Query to publish a dataflow. The auto date/time allows power bi report authors to use the data model to filter, group, and drill down by using calendar time period i.e. If I answered your question I would be happy if you could mark my post as a solution, How to Get Your Question Answered Quickly, Number of Employees Who Left in Department. Hope this helps! You can specify which column to use by selecting the table in the Fields pane, then right-click the table and choose Mark as date table > Date table settings. Read more, This article describes the possible rounding differences that can appear in DAX. This code generates a six-digit text for year and month combined which will be always in the right order if converted to a number; It doesnt matter what format you used for the label column, the code column can sort it, by using the Sort by Column option. Dashboard Sharing and Manage Permissions in Power BI; Simple, but Useful? DAX YEAR Function. Returns a logical value indicating whether the given Date/DateTime/DateTimeZone occurred during the next quarter, as determined by the current date and time on the system. and create hierarchies and models. We can think of a calendar table as a lookup table for date groupings. Read: How to change data source in Power BI. This will now order the months in chronological order. How to get a DATE TABLE easily in Power BI Guy in a Cube 322K subscribers Join Subscribe 1.1K Share 52K views 9 months ago #GuyInACube #PowerBI #Dates Do you use a central date table. While using power bi, you will find that you need a date reference for your data to organize it by months or weeks. Indicates whether the given datetime value dateTime occurs during the next day, as determined by the current date and time on the system. How can I list the Week Ending dates in descending order with check boxes? Well use CALENDAR to create a date table. It also handles incrementing the month and year potions of the value as appropriate. They can see the four-level of date hierarchy: Year, Quarter, Month, Day. I'm wondering why you have to because if I enter values like this (using enter data), The query editor changes this automatically to a datetime column. We only want to see . A date dimension will have a range of dates with attributes such as Month Name, Year, Financial Quarter, Financial Semester and Financial Year. Now, we will create a calendar table from 01st Jan 2019 to 31st Jan 2019. The table needs to include one DateTime type column. You can also select the table and then choose Mark as date table from the Table tools ribbon, shown here. In the previous example, we continued to use a two-columns approach for the Month and Day of Week attributes. The Date table has a hierarchy, even though this does not cause side effects on the format: By using the new Date table, we obtain the following matrixes where the Year Month and Month columns display the desired text instead of the underlying dates. The above image shows the sample data of by existing date table in power query, now we need to create a new column using the M language. Returns the minute as a number from 0 to 59, given a date and time value. In power bi, when an auto date/time table exists for a date column, that column is visible, power bi report authors wont find that column in a fields pane. Then expand the date column, by clicking on expand icon you can see the numbers. All in One: Script to Create Calendar Table or Date Dimension - RADACAD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. And this gives me the right ordered list of year-month values as below in any visual; Note that, it is recommended to hide the Year-Month code column from the report view. Returns a logical value indicating whether the given Date/DateTime/DateTimeZone occurred during the previous week, as determined by the current date and time on the system. To make the purpose of this table clear, lets name it Date Table: As you can see, after writing CALENDAR, Power BI will give you a hint on how to finish the expression similar to how Excel does it. No problem! Now we will see how to create a data table on Power BI Desktop by following these easy steps: First, we have to create a Date table naming as Date. on create date column from month and year power bi, what happened to keyshawn johnson's daughter that passed away, houses for rent by owner in fort pierce, fl, Ghost Recon Breakpoint Who Is The Strategist Clue Locations, hoi4 befriend czechoslovakia or demand sudetenland, all the light we cannot see ending explained, 15741239f0293c500 cavalier king charles spaniel rescue near nashville tn. The data has already been aggregated into this format in Excel so I don't even know if I would have access to individual dates for this. Find out more about the online and in person events happening in March! Read more, This article describes how to implement a DAX measure to run faster than what you get from the built-in fusion optimization. In the structure section, next to the data type you can change it to Date, as per your need. By properly setting the custom format string the user cannot see the difference, and the model only requires one column instead of two columns for each of these attributes. This is how we can create a Date table relationship on Power BI. For this the M query is: Similarly, we will create other costume columns for Months and quarters. Created an AI database tool where you ask questions and it generates the query code. not by a particular date (example: 01/05/2021). If so, how do you create one? Then, have all data modelers connect to the dataflow to add date tables to their models. Well-prepared tables connected by relationships are required to function together to allow visualizations to be sliced and diced by data from different tables. Use Power Query Editor to add a custom column. To work with the DAX time intelligence function, the Power Bi model requires at least one date type column. Now we will change the data type to date. My sample table just have a single column; Date as below; If you are going to use the month NAME as part of the year-month combination, then you will need a label column and a code column. year, month, Qtr, date.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. And in this way, the model calculation can leverage the DAX time intelligence capabilities. We can use it to lookup a date, and return the year, quarter, month number, month name, week number, weekday name . Yelp Dataset Photos photo.json. ADDCOLUMNS lets you specify columns for Date. Power BI Desktop generates this data by creating hidden tables on your behalf, which you can then use for your reports and DAX expressions. Do I need a date table if all of my data only contains a month and a year, but not a date? And the recalculation tables date range when dates for a new year are loaded into power bi model. Making statements based on opinion; back them up with references or personal experience. Now we will remove the Start date and end date as they have repetitive values. I'm new to Power BI and I understand that creating a date table is one of the first things you should do, but the data I'm working with is by month and year, (example: January 2020, February 2019, etc.) Date table with Financial year date - Power BI And also power bi desktop creates a relationship between the auto date/time tables Date column and the model date column. The Date column cant have missing dates the dates must be contiguous. Generate Year and Month Combinations in Power BI Report using DAX, Power BI Architecture Brisbane 2022 Training Course, Power BI Architecture Sydney 2022 Training Course, Power BI Architecture Melbourne 2022 Training Course, you can use that to sort the Year-Month column, All in One: Script to Create Date Dimension in Power BI using Power Query, Add Leading Zeros to a Number in Power BI Using Power Query. Remove both the Start Date and End Date column except Dates. You can then use Power Query to connect to the date table. PURPOSE The purpose of this policy from TechRepublic Premium is to provide procedures and protocols for supporting effective organizational asset management specifically focused on electronic devices. Converts hours, minutes, and seconds given as numbers to a time in datetime format. For example, here we picked a start date i.e. YEAR function How to generate the Date Column From Year Column using Power QueryIf you don't have the Date column in the source table but you have only year or Month Year . In my case I wanted the result to be the full month name and abbreviated year (ex: September '19). If you're developing a DirectQuery model and your data source doesn't include a date table, we strongly recommend you add a date table to the data source. Welcome to our first of the Power BI Tips series. To work with Data Analysis Expressions (DAX) time intelligence functions, there's a prerequisite model requirement: You must have at least one date table in your model. Then from the formatting section change, the format of your data which fits your need. How to know if the Auto Date table is adequate when using Power BI, Google Workspace vs. Microsoft 365: A side-by-side analysis w/checklist, download the Microsoft Power BI demo file, Date and time functions (DAX) DAX | Microsoft Learn, Windows 11 cheat sheet: Everything you need to know, Best software for businesses and end users, TechRepublic Premium editorial calendar: IT policies, checklists, toolkits and research for download, ChatGPT cheat sheet: Complete guide for 2023, The Best Payroll Software for Your Small Business in 2023, 1Password is looking to a password-free future. If necessary, choose New from the File menu so youre working with a new .pbix file. It's important to note that when you specify your own date table, Power BI Desktop doesn't auto-create the hierarchies that it would otherwise build into your model on your behalf. Generate Year and Month Combinations in Power BI Report using DAX, Power BI Architecture Auckland 2023 Training Course, Power BI Architecture Sydney 2022 Training Course, Power BI Architecture Melbourne 2022 Training Course, Power BI Architecture Brisbane 2022 Training Course, you can use that to sort the Year-Month column, All in One: Script to Create Date Dimension in Power BI using Power Query, Add Leading Zeros to a Number in Power BI Using Power Query, Dynamic Row Level Security with Power BI Made Simple. Click Add to hierarchy > Year hierarchy: The next step adds the Month value to the existing hierarchy as follows: 0. Be your company's Microsoft insider by reading these Windows and Office tips, tricks, and cheat sheets. It should meet all the modeling requirements of a date table. You don't want to work in an existing .pbix file. Steps as per above illustrations: Fire up Power BI Desktop > edit query > Select your date table > select the date column > Add Column tab > Date button > Month > Month (again) > Select the Home tab > Closed and Apply. The auto date and time option deliver fast convenient and easy to use time intelligence. After you specify a date table, you can select which column in that table is the date column. The following expression returns the month from the date in the TransactionDate column of the Orders table. The case when you are connecting with the data warehouse, as it will have a date dimension table. Power bi creates a date table in the power query. The second scenario is where you use a table from Analysis Services, for example, with a dim date field that you want to use as your date table. In the right-hand corner of the slicer, just under the ellipsis (3 dots), next to the eraser icon, there is a drop-down list, click on this and select List. This is because we are unlikely to use a continuous line chart for these two attributes. Also important to note is that when you mark a table as a date table, Power BI Desktop removes the built-in (automatically created) date table. Zero to Hero: Become an Excel-Superuser in 14 hours, VBA Masterclass: Become a VBA-Pro in 20 hours, Power BI Essentials: Learn Power BI in 12 hours, Team Solution: For Businesses and Organizations. However, if you dont Ill explain how you can create these formats easily using DAX. Find out about what's going on in Power BI by reading blogs written by community members and product staff. Power BI User Access Levels: Build and Edit are different, The importance of knowing different types of Power BI users; a governance approach, Power BI Workspace; Collaborative DEV Environment, One or two-digits month number (no leading zero). Over the past two weeks, I have been asked the same question by people who have just started the awesome journey towards revolutionizing their reporting experience through Power BI: Instead of the default alphabetical sorting, how do I sort the months in my charts by natural month order?. All you have to do is create your own table and use DAX functions to define it. FORMAT (
Is Melissa Mcgurren Married,
Somerset High School Football State Championship,
Newport County Players Wages,
Articles P